Beet and Goat Cheese Log

Ingredients

Scale
  • 3 medium beets, roasted and finely chopped
  • 8 oz goat cheese, softened
  • 1 tbsp chopped fresh dill or chives

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Wrap each beet in foil and place on a baking sheet. Roast for 45-60 minutes until tender. Once cooled, peel and finely chop.
  2. In a mixing bowl, combine softened goat cheese with chopped dill or chives. Mix until well blended.
  3. Gently fold in the finely chopped roasted beets without mashing them too much.
  4. Place a piece of plastic wrap on your counter and spoon the beet and cheese mixture onto it, shaping it into a log. Use the wrap to help form it tightly.
  5. Wrap the log securely in pl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least one hour before serving.
  6. Unwrap and slice into rounds before serving with assorted crackers or fresh vegetables.
